What does a Data Engineer Intern do?

A Data Engineer Intern supports the design, development, and maintenance of data pipelines and databases within an organization. They assist in collecting, cleaning, and organizing raw data, ensuring it is accessible and usable for data analysts and scientists. Interns may work with various tools and programming languages such as SQL, Python, and cloud platforms to help manage large datasets. Their responsibilities often include troubleshooting data issues, optimizing data workflows, and learning best practices in data engineering. This role provides hands-on experience in data infrastructure and is an excellent starting point for a career in data engineering.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Data Engineer Intern?

To thrive as a Data Engineer Intern, you typically need a solid understanding of programming languages like Python or Java, introductory experience with data structures, and familiarity with databases, often supported by coursework in computer science or related fields. Familiarity with tools such as SQL, cloud platforms (e.g., AWS or Azure), and data pipeline frameworks like Apache Spark or Airflow is common and highly valued.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ication help interns collaborate and learn quickly in team environments. These skills and traits are crucial for building, maintaining, and optimizing data systems that support reliable analysis and business insights.

What is the difference between Data Engineer Intern vs Data Analyst Intern?

AspectData Engineer InternData Analyst Intern
Required SkillsSQL, Python, ETL, data pipeline developmentExcel, SQL, data visualization tools
Work EnvironmentData engineering teams, cloud platformsBusiness intelligence teams, reporting tools
Industry UsageTech, finance, healthcareRetail, marketing, finance

Data Engineer Interns focus on building and maintaining data pipelines and infrastructure, requiring programming and database skills. Data Analyst Interns analyze data to generate insights, emphasizing visualization and reporting. Both roles are common in data-driven industries but serve different functions within organizations.
